Core Viewpoint - Recent trends indicate a strong performance in gold prices, with COMEX gold surpassing $4600 per ounce, driven by liquidity easing and increased demand for safe-haven assets, suggesting a potential continuation of the bull market in the metals sector [3][4]. Group 1: Gold Price Dynamics - As of January 12, COMEX gold reached a historic high of over $4600 per ounce, supported by macroeconomic factors such as the deepening Federal Reserve rate cut cycle and rising geopolitical uncertainties [3]. - The ongoing demand for gold from global central banks remains robust, contributing to the upward pressure on prices [3]. Group 2: Supply Constraints in Base Metals - Key base metals like copper, aluminum, and nickel are facing supply challenges, which are expected to support price increases. Recent strikes and production halts in major mining operations have exacerbated supply issues [3][4]. - Specific incidents include a strike at the Mantoverde copper mine in Chile and indefinite shutdowns at the Mozal aluminum plant in Mozambique, indicating significant supply disruptions [3]. Group 3: Investment Opportunities in Mining ETFs - The mining ETF (561330) has shown a remarkable performance, with a net inflow of nearly 600 million yuan over ten consecutive days, reflecting strong investor interest [1][4]. - The mining ETF is positioned to outperform due to a higher concentration of leading stocks, with the top ten holdings accounting for 55.82% of the index, compared to 47.93% in the broader base metals index [4][7]. Group 4: Future Market Outlook - The copper market is expected to benefit from supply-demand imbalances and the favorable conditions of a rate cut cycle, which historically leads to price increases [12]. - The aluminum sector is constrained by production limits and strong demand from new energy sectors, suggesting sustained high prices [12]. - Lithium demand is projected to rise due to energy storage needs, with a potential supply-demand balance expected by 2026 [13]. - The rare earth sector may see profit elasticity and valuation improvements as China eases export restrictions, highlighting its strategic importance in global markets [14].
